Abstract
ISO 23551-4:2005 specifies safety, constructional and performance requirements of valve-proving systems, hereafter referred to as VPS, intended for use with gas burners and gas-burning appliances. It also describes the test procedures for checking compliance with these requirements and provides information necessary for the purchaser and user. ISO 23551-4:2005 applies to all types of VPS which are used for the automatic detection of leakage in a gas burner section having at least two valves designed in accordance with ISO 23551-1 and which give a signal if the leakage of one of the valves exceeds the detection limit.
ISO 23551-4:2005 applies to VPSs with a declared maximum working pressure up to and including 500 kPa for use in systems using fuel gases.
ISO 23551-4:2005 does not apply to VPSs for use in explosive atmospheres.
